Overall Meaning

In Kanye West's song Jail, he addresses his relationships and a possible run-in with the law. The chorus repeats the phrase "guess who's going to jail tonight?" which highlights the uncertainty and fear that Kanye may be experiencing. He mentions changing his number to avoid communication with someone who has caused him violence, which adds to the theme of fear and tension. He also mentions having "priors," suggesting that he has a criminal record, which could be the reason for his fear of going to jail. Throughout the song, Kanye mentions his faith and his belief that God will help him.


The verse where Kanye says "I'll be honest, we all liars" highlights the internal conflict that he may be facing. He acknowledges that he and others may not always tell the truth, but he also seems to be grappling with his own sense of morality. The second verse switches gears and focuses on Kanye's relationship, with him calling out his partner for choosing to end things. The phrase "guess who's getting exed" refers to the abrupt end to their relationship, and he suggests that she is to blame for the breakup.


Overall, the song Jail explores themes of fear, uncertainty, faith, and morality. Kanye's lyrics paint a picture of a man struggling to make sense of the world around him and to come to terms with his own actions and choices.
